Sustainability is becoming an increasingly important topic for students when researching where to study, and universities are making quick changes to further their green credentials and demonstrate why they're a great study destination .
According to green office movement, a sustainable university is an educational institution that educates global citizens for sustainable development, offers relevant insights on urgent societal challenges and reduces the environmental and social footprints of its campus operations, empowers students and staff to act, and makes sustainability a central priority.(https://www.greenofficemovement.org/
